How this VIN pattern is read
A 17-character VIN carries two kinds of information: what was built, and which one it is. This page is the first kind — the nine highlighted positions.
| Positions | Characters | What they encode |
|---|---|---|
| 1–3 | 3C6 | CHRYSLER DE MEXICO TOLUCA · World manufacturer identifier |
| 4–8 | 3R3HJ | Model, body style, engine and restraint system |
| 9 | × | Check digit — computed per vehicle, not part of the build |
| 10 | M | Model year — 2021 |
| 11 | × | Assembly plant |
| 12–17 | ×××××× | Production sequence number, unique to each vehicle |
